The Role This is an application implementation role with heavy SQL development like Stored procedures, views, SQL query optimization, application configuration, deployment and some .NET development.Deploy, configure and initialize client environments as part of the Technical Services team that delivers configured/customized solutions for clientsImplement portal solution from base product, implement custom web modules, web services, and workflows using industry best practicesEstimate effort for queued work items and evaluate technical feasibility for requests.Work with delivery teams to define requirements, manage expectations and assist with the analysis of issuesWear multiple hats at times as a developer and as an business analyst to analyze requirements, ask questions, raise concerns etc.Ensure requirements for changes and enhancements are properly defined and follow appropriate channels for testing and migrating to test and production environmentsDevelop comprehensive test plans, scripts and cases, participate in code reviewsPerform unit and comprehensive testing to ensure overall functionality and technical quality of deliverablesFollow documentation, process and protocols during product implementations. Identify areas of improvement in documentation and help improve itTroubleshoot technical issues and problems and assist with client issue escalations from support The Requirements Critical thinking skills: Problem solver, motivation to begin and continue tasks without external instructions, drive to collect information and pinpoint issues, examine, scrutinize and draw conclusions3+ years work experience in SQL Server 2008 and TSQL. This role involves heavy SQL Server and transactional SQL development and minimal C#/ASP.NET development3+ years work experience developing and/or supporting web-based applications (.NET, ASP.NET, C# preferred).SQL Server Management Studio, Visual Studio, GIT, Team Foundation Server, IIS ConfigurationClient-side technologies: JavaScript, JQuery, CSS, HTML5/CSS3.Communication skills: The ability to articulate and able to communicate with people from different functional areas including internal and external stakeholdersFamiliarity with SaaS business modelNice to have: Windows Services, PowerShell, Familiarity of Content management systems, Azure/AWS Fundamentals, SingleSignOnNightshift